Job Responsibility:

  • Build collaborative relationships with product and business groups to deliver AI-driven impact
  • Research and implement state-of-the-art using foundation models, prompt engineering, RAG, graphs, multi-agent architectures, as well as classical machine learning techniques
  • Fine-tune foundation models using domain-specific datasets
  • Evaluate model behavior on relevance, bias, hallucination, and response quality via offline evaluations, shadow experiments, online experiments, and ROI analysis
  • Build rapid AI solution prototypes, contribute to production deployment of these solutions, debug production code, support MLOps/AIOps
  • Contribute to papers, patents, and conference presentations
  • Translate research into production-ready solutions and measure their impact through A/B testing and telemetry that address customer needs
  • Ability to use data to identify gaps in AI quality, uncover insights and implement PoCs to show proof of concepts
  • Demonstrate deep expertise in AI subfields (e.g., deep learning, Generative AI, NLP, muti-modal models) to translate cutting-edge research into practical, real-world solutions that drive product innovation and business impact
  • Share insights on industry trends and applied technologies with engineering and product teams
  • Formulate strategic plans that integrate state-of-the-art research to meet business goals
  • Maintain clear documentation of experiments, results, and methodologies
  • Share findings through internal forums, newsletters, and demos to promote innovation and knowledge sharing
  • Apply a deep understanding of fairness and bias in AI by proactively identifying and mitigating ethical and security risks—including XPIA (Cross-Prompt Injection Attack) unfairness, bias, and privacy concerns—to ensure equitable and responsible outcomes
  • Ensure responsible AI practices throughout the development lifecycle, from data collection to deployment and monitoring
  • Contribute to internal ethics and privacy policies and ensure responsible AI practice throughout AI development cycle from data collection to model development, deployment, and monitoring
  • Deep understanding of small and large language models architecture, Deep learning, fine tuning techniques, multi-agent architectures, classical ML, and optimization techniques to adapt out-of-the-box solutions to particular business problems
  • Prepare and analyze data for machine learning, identifying optimal features and addressing data gaps
  • Develop, train, and evaluate machine learning models and algorithms to solve complex business problems, using modern frameworks and state-of-the-art models, open-source libraries, statistical tools, and rigorous metrics
  • Address scalability and performance issues using large-scale computing frameworks
